(Can) Pours cloudy amber with tiny white head. Pleasant aroma of biscuit and pine. Smooth medium body with fine soft carbonation. Nicely balanced taste. There’s a nice biscuit malt in the background. Citrus fruit sits on the top from start trough the mid palate then some nice hop bitterness builds. Very drinkable.

Pours clear gold with a large lasting head.Nose shows lychee, passion fruit, mango, peach, pear and clean malt.Flavours include soft tropical fruit, a bit of biscuity malt, and then transitions to a harsh, astringent bitterness with a metallic and grainy note.

Can from Brewcraft at home (bought at Brewcraft 7th anniversary party). Golden straw yellow pour with foamy rich white head. Aroma is pilsner crispness with melon mineral grassy hops, vegetal hop bite. Sweet malt. Taste follows - crisp pilsner bite, with melon, apple, grassy bitterness. Thin palate. Crisp finish. Not bad.

355ml can into schooner. Thanks to Ratebeer and Beer Cartel. Crystal clear golden beer with a tightly packed foamy white head and many tiny bubbles. Nose is pine, earthy, some background caramel. Nice. some lacing. Excellent body, smooth and viscous. Slight effervescence on the swallow. Superb taste and finish. There's grapefruit and stonefruit then a lingering woody dry finish but also hints of raisins and Turkish delight. Excellent beer, complex yet easy to drink.

Canned 3/20. Pale clear gold with a cm of white head. Aroma of sweet pineapple, pine, mandarin, light bread. Light bodied with moderate carbonation. Very clean with just a little malt sweetness and a hint more from the fruit before a snappy dry and somewhat resinous finish. Austere, almost aperitif style beer Kind of what IPLs are going for but rarely find. Offers punch not grunt (or character) for the ABV. Interesting.
